Abstract

Y-1-L cells, a subline of the Y-1 functional murine adrenocortical tumor cell line, were enucleated with cytochalasin B and the response of these enucleated cells to ACTH and dibutyryl cyclic AMP (dbcAMP) was examined. Enucleated Y-1-L cells maintained a basal steroid output for at least 24 h and responded to either ACTH (10 mU/ml) or dbcAMP (1 mM) by a change from flat to rounded cell shape, and by increased steroidogenesis. The steroidogenic response of enucleated cells during the first 3 h after enucleation was highly significant and, though it decreased rapidly thereafter, it persisted to a limited degree for up to 12 h. On the other hand, the morphologic change could be induced even at 33 h after enucleation. The results of this study show that the nucleus is not required for the expression of the acute effects of ACTH or dbcAMP and that the cytoplasmic components necessary for cell 'rounding' and a steroidogenic response are stable for 36 h and 12 h, respectively.

摘要

Y-1-L细胞是功能性小鼠肾上腺皮质肿瘤细胞系Y-1的一个亚系,用细胞松弛素B去核后,检测这些去核细胞对促肾上腺皮质激素(ACTH)和二丁酰环磷腺苷(dbcAMP)的反应。去核的Y-1-L细胞至少24小时维持基础类固醇分泌,对ACTH(10 mU/ml)或dbcAMP(1 mM)的反应是细胞形态从扁平变为圆形,并增加类固醇生成。去核后最初3小时内,去核细胞的类固醇生成反应非常显著,尽管此后迅速下降,但在长达12小时内仍有限度地持续存在。另一方面,甚至在去核后33小时仍可诱导形态变化。本研究结果表明,ACTH或dbcAMP的急性效应表达不需要细胞核,细胞“变圆”和类固醇生成反应所需的细胞质成分分别在36小时和12小时内保持稳定。
